Output 71ff91dd842a59cf0f47aba975a9b8786f4e995578066e99d33f5a3dd25434a4:0

value
129815736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aba8f2afc609158e2b00c03e932a2ba4aa25071 OP_EQUAL
address
3HFkHX3d1pb1QE7EqXMnpjLs3wYpkg1URL
transaction
71ff91dd842a59cf0f47aba975a9b8786f4e995578066e99d33f5a3dd25434a4
spent
true